JOB TITLE: Survey Co-ordinator

DIVISION: Building Consultancy – Structural Surveys

LOCATION: Daresbury

We are seeking a highly organised and motivated Survey Co-ordinator to join our Structural Surveys team. This role will provide essential day-to-day administrative and operational support to our Engineers, ensuring the smooth running of the business.

This is an excellent opportunity for a candidate with strong administrative experience who is keen to further develop their skills within a professional and supportive environment.

To be successful in the role you will need to demonstrate a commitment to innovation and a determination to provide a market leading service and product on behalf of Structural Surveys, a QuestGates Company.

Key Skills:

  • Excellent communication skills, both oral and written
  • Strong IT literacy, particularly in Microsoft Office (Word and Excel)
  • Demonstrate personal and professional integrity and lead by example
  • Ability to work and contribute positively as part of a team and in isolation
  • Ability to work accurately under pressure, adhering to deadlines and service standards
  • Professional and confident telephone manner

The role involves:

  • To demonstrate a high level of technical quality and service delivery
  • To provide exceptional customer service at all times
  • To participate positively and constructively as a team member, sharing knowledge and providing feedback and suggestions
  • To use internal systems such as GoReport (training provided)
  • To handle client enquiries via phone and email, arranging survey appointments
  • To proactively follow up enquiries to convert them into confirmed jobs
  • To manage Engineers diaries and booking schedules using internal systems
  • To maintain accurate electronic filing systems and carry out general administrative duties
  • To distribute service review requests and gather customer feedback

The Package:

  • Competitive salary
  • Enhanced contributory pension
  • Performance related bonus
  • Flexible benefits
  • Enhanced family leave
  • Electric car scheme
  • Voluntary benefits schemes
  • Birthday holiday
  • Share purchase scheme with interest free loans

Hours of work:

Standard working week is 35 hours, Monday to Friday with flexibility to work from home/office.

Closing Date for Applications:

Close of business on Friday 31st July 2026.
